Jazz Caffe #1, california jazz conservatory


The California Jazz Conservatory (CJC), a 40 year old Berkeley Institution, is a renown graduate jazz school in Downtown Berkeley. After the original JazzCaffé flooded in the basement , the CJC investigated possible restoration of the damaged JazzCaffé into a remodeled and upgraded version of the old design.

The CJC wanted the café (by day) to provide food and beverages to students, jazz instructors, and foot traffic during the day. By night, the café would also provide food and beverages to jazz patrons who attended a small jazz concert nearby. The café is on the same block as the nationally known Berkeley Repertory Theatre, the Aurora theatre and the Freight & Salvage venue. 

The CJC decided to relocate the Jazz Caffè to a street level location in their second building across the street. This new venue was constructed and became Jazz Caffè #2.
